How Blockchain Works
Blockchain operates on a peer-to-peer network, where each participant (or node) maintains a copy of the ledger. Transactions are bundled into blocks, which are then linked together in chronological order, creating a chain. Each block contains a cryptographic hash of the previous block, ensuring that any attempt to alter the data in a block would require changing all subsequent blocks, making the blockchain tamper-evident.
Key Features of Blockchain
- Decentralization: Unlike traditional centralized systems, blockchain operates on a decentralized network, making it resistant to censorship and single points of failure.
- Transparency: The data on a blockchain is visible to all participants in real-time, promoting transparency and accountability.
- Security: Blockchain uses advanced cryptographic techniques to secure transactions, ensuring that once recorded, data cannot be altered retroactively.
- Immutability: Once a transaction is recorded on the blockchain, it is practically immutable, providing a robust audit trail.
Applications of Blockchain
- Finance: Blockchain underpins cryptocurrencies like Bitcoin and Ethereum, enabling fast, secure, and low-cost peer-to-peer transactions without intermediaries.
- Supply Chain Management: Blockchain improves transparency and traceability across supply chains, reducing fraud and ensuring the authenticity of goods.
- Healthcare: Blockchain can securely store and share medical records, ensuring patient privacy and data integrity.
- Smart Contracts: Self-executing contracts coded on blockchain, which automatically execute and enforce the terms of an agreement when predefined conditions are met.
- Governance: Blockchain can enable transparent and secure voting systems, reducing electoral fraud and increasing voter participation.
